Starting from knowing close to nothing

Featured Replies

Hi my name is Sean I'm a firefighter in pa. I've always love gta and I'm getting a new computer and gta 4 on it specifically to mod and play lcpdfr. I really want to download the gangreen script mod fire fighting and paramedic I have absolutely no idea where to start and I can't find a tutorial anywhere or step by step directions on doing this. I wanna know how to add multiple fire trucks EMS units and the different liveries and the whole light controls thing and siren mods. Can I put specific sirens on specific vehicles? What programs do I need to download to begin modding, and can a play with a 360 controller plugged into the USB port? Then use the chat pad to do everything I've been looking for a good week for a tutorial or step by step directions and what kind of computer spec, etc should I look for that's in a $300ish budget give or take $50 bucks you can email or comment me when ever this will keep me occupied through EMS duty nights on my 12 hour stand by and free time very appreciated from a fellow gta lover

I can answer most. however with gangreen's fire fighter script i'm not 100% sure, but since it's a script then it should just install like every other script, there should be a readme file within the download that gives you instructions on how to install it.

 

as for vehicle mods, to "add" cars you'll need a program called OpenIV, then you'll need to add them from there. although it may be a bit of a struggle to do it as a beginner (YouTube should have a few tutorials on how to do it), for liveries a mod can support up to 4 liveries (although it could be more) so with the 4 liveries you can use in game you'll need to put +livery at the end of that specificc vehicle "line" in the Vehicle.ide or Vehicle.DAT file (not sure which one it is). As for sirens, you can only use one siren since GTA uses one siren for all emergency vehicles, so you can add a siren for different vehicles unfortunately.

 

For your controller, yes you can use a controller for your driving, ped walking, shooting etc and then use your numpad for the scripts (i have done this since i started playing gta 4 on the PC). and for your budget, you might be able to get a PC for that price, although normally for a decent gaming computer it is normally $500. just look on google for GTA 4 PC Specs and find a PC suitable with the specs (get something just a little bit over so you can run smoothly with mods)
